Background
There are over 355 million menstruating women and girls in India. About 50 per cent of women aged 15-24 years do not have safe menstrual health practices. UNICEF says in addition to girls and women, transgender men and non-binary persons are also unable to manage their menstrual cycle in a dignified and healthy way. There are more than 49 lac adolescents' girls, women and people in Delhi who menstruates.
Menses Health Project
Through Menses Health Project, Matri Sudha is going to install sanitary pads vending machines in government schools and public places. The goal of the project is to break taboos around menstruation, increasing awareness, giving access to affordable menstrual products (herein sanitary pads at public places). The two positions of Project Coordinator- Menses Health Project are created for successful execution of the project in NCT of Delhi. One project coordinator will oversee the implementation of the project in government schools and other coordinator will be required to implement the project at public places.
